Test Taking Tips
Code:
*If you aren't sure to which answer, choose the most informative one.
*Eat a good breakfast.
*Get a good night sleep (8-10 hrs)
*On Multiple Choice, usually no more than 1 question will have the same answer than a previous question. Don't continuously choose the same answer.



Studying Tips
Code:
*Don't cram, study days before the test, then on the day before it refresh as much information as you can.

Study the day before.

Get a good night's sleep (8-10 hours).

It's scientifically proven that if you sleep well after you study, you retain more of the information on the next day.

Don't continue studying if you're bored half to death or feel sleepy. It won't get stored in your memory or you'll only remember fragments of it.

Take breaks. Too much study is counterproductive.
